The Rich Background of Diamonds: From Ancient Times to Modern High-end



Although Diamond have mesmerized human creativity for centuries, their journey from old adornments to signs of contemporary luxury shows a complex interaction of society, craftsmanship, and commerce. Found in India, these gemstones were prized for their firmness and brilliance, typically worn by nobility as amulets of power and defense. Old civilizations thought Diamond had mystical qualities, associating them with the ability to ward off bad.


As profession courses increased, Diamond infected Europe, becoming related to riches and condition. The Renaissance marked a substantial juncture, as the art of Diamond cutting began to progress, enhancing their attraction. By the 19th century, Diamond were extensively set in the deluxe market, specifically adhering to the exploration of huge deposits in South Africa. Today, Diamond fashion jewelry symbolizes not only personal landmarks yet additionally a deep social relevance, flawlessly linking custom and modernity in its long-lasting charm.

Evaluating Color High Quality



Examining shade high quality is important in determining a diamond's overall value and charm. Diamond are rated on a color range from D (colorless) to Z (light yellow or brown), with colorless Diamond being the most demanded. The lack of shade allows for maximum light reflection, improving luster and fire. As Diamond progress down the scale, their shade ends up being more visible, which can influence their desirability and price. It is essential for purchasers to comprehend that refined distinctions in shade can substantially affect a ruby's charm. Furthermore, the Diamond's cut can influence exactly how color is regarded. A well-cut Diamond might mask mild shade blemishes, making it show up a lot more lively. Cautious consideration of shade high quality is important for informed buying choices.

Famous Diamond Fashion Jewelry Styles Through the Ages



Throughout history, Diamond jewelry has actually evolved into a sign of sophistication and status, showing the imaginative and cultural patterns of each era. In the Victorian duration, elaborate designs including enchanting settings and flower concepts ended up being popular, showcasing the craftsmanship of the moment. The Art Deco activity introduced vibrant colors and geometric shapes, highlighting modernity and sophistication in Diamond items.


Throughout the mid-20th century, the introduction of the solitaire Diamond ring redefined interaction precious jewelry, symbolizing simpleness and timelessness. The 1980s and 1990s experienced the rise of statement items, with oversized Diamond and cutting-edge styles that recorded the spirit of extravagance.


Today, modern styles frequently mix vintage impacts with minimalist appearances, attracting diverse preferences. Each iconic style not only highlights the Diamond' sparkle yet also acts as a representation of the changing values and preferences throughout background, ensuring the allure of Diamond precious jewelry continues to be ever-present.

Caring for Your Diamond Precious Jewelry: Maintenance and Cleaning



Keeping the luster of Diamond fashion jewelry calls for normal treatment and interest. To maintain the shimmer of Diamond, diamond jewelry collection proprietors ought to clean their items often, preferably every few weeks. An easy service of cozy water and moderate recipe soap can properly eliminate dust and oils that build up with time. Using a soft tooth brush, one can carefully scrub the Diamond and its setup, guaranteeing that no deposit remains.


Furthermore, it is advisable to keep Diamond fashion jewelry separately in a soft pouch or a lined box to stop scraping. Normal examinations by an expert jeweler can assist recognize any type of loosened rocks or damages that might need repair work. Stay clear of revealing Diamond to extreme chemicals or abrasive products, as these can boring their shine. By complying with these upkeep suggestions, people can ensure that their Diamond jewelry retains its classic sophistication for generations to find.


The Future of Diamond Jewelry: Fads and Innovations



The future of Diamond precious jewelry is poised for remarkable transformation, driven by progressing customer choices and innovative modern technologies. As sustainability comes to be a priority, lab-grown Diamond are obtaining popularity as a result of their honest sourcing and lowered ecological effect. Customers are progressively looking for openness in the Diamond market, prompting brand names to take on blockchain modern technology for traceability.


In addition, personalization is arising as a considerable fad, with customization alternatives permitting people to develop special pieces that resonate with their individual tales. Developments in 3D printing are enabling designers to experiment with intricate styles, making bespoke precious jewelry much more obtainable.
